# Job Description – Planning Manager (Interior Fit-Out)
The Planning Manager is responsible for leading project planning, scheduling, monitoring, and reporting activities across multiple interior fit-out projects. The role ensures projects are delivered on time, within budget, and in accordance with contractual milestones by implementing effective planning and project control systems. The Planning Manager works closely with project managers, design teams, procurement, commercial, and site execution teams to optimize project performance and mitigate schedule risks.
## Key Responsibilities
### Project Planning & Scheduling
* Develop detailed baseline project schedules using Primavera P6/MS Project.
* Prepare project execution plans, master schedules, milestone schedules, and look-ahead plans.
* Define Work Breakdown Structure (WBS) for all projects.
* Establish project timelines based on scope, resource availability, and contractual requirements.
* Prepare resource-loaded and cost-loaded schedules where applicable.
* Develop recovery and acceleration plans for delayed projects.
### Project Monitoring & Control
* Monitor project progress against approved baseline schedules.
* Track planned vs. actual progress on a weekly and monthly basis.
* Identify delays, critical activities, and potential bottlenecks.
* Conduct schedule variance and critical path analysis.
* Recommend corrective actions to maintain project timelines.
* Ensure timely completion of project milestones.
### Reporting
* Prepare daily, weekly, and monthly project progress reports.
* Develop dashboards and KPI reports for management and clients.
* Present project status during internal and client review meetings.
* Generate S-Curves, Earned Value reports, resource histograms, and progress charts.
